摘要

Vaginal rings (VRs) loaded with microbicides may prove to be useful in the prevention of heterosexual transmission of HIV by providing sustained drug delivery over an extended period of time. Combinations of microbicides in VRs may result in increased efficacy of these products. In this study, silicone elastomer VRs loaded with the microbicide candidates dapivirine (a reverse transcriptase inhibitor) and maraviroc (a chemokine receptor antagonist) were assessed in a preclinical stability study. VRs were stored at 30°C/65% relative humidity (RH) or 40°C/75% RH and in vitro release of both drugs was assessed at TO, Tl, T2 and T3 months, in order to evaluate whether any significant changes in the release profiles occurred following storage at these conditions.
